dc.description.abstract | This study reports the comparison of heat transfer and friction factor characteristics of helical screw inserts in Al2O3-water and carbon nano-tube-water nano-fluids through a straight pipe in transition regime with constant heat flux boundary condition. Experiments were carried out by using 0.15% volume concentration of Al2O3-water and carbon nano-tube-water nano-fluid with helical tape inserts of twist ratio, TR = 1.5, 2.5, and 3. The thermal performance of helical screw tape inserts with the carbon nano-tube-water nano-fluid is found -to be higher when compared to the Al2O3-water nano-fluid. In addition, the maximum enhancement in heat transfer was obtained for the carbon nano-tube-water nano-fluid with helical tape inserts of twist ratio 1.5. The increase in pressure drop of the Al2O3-water nano-fluid with helical screw tape inserts is found to be higher compared to the carbon nano-tube-water nano-fluid helical screw tape inserts at lower value of twist ratio. © Taylor & Francis Group, LLC 2016. | en_US |
